Understanding CRM Deployment vs. Implementation
To grasp the complexities of a successful CRM rollout, it’s essential to distinguish between deployment and implementation. CRM implementation typically refers to the narrower, technical aspects of installing and configuring the software itself. This includes setting up the core functionalities, customizing fields, and establishing basic workflows.
CRM deployment, on the other hand, is a far more expansive, end-to-end process. It signifies the complete journey of bringing a CRM system to full operational status within an organization. This encompasses everything from the initial alignment of business goals with system requirements, through the technical implementation, to the crucial stages of data migration, user training, the actual go-live, and the sustained post-launch optimization efforts. In essence, implementation gets the CRM software running, while deployment ensures the entire business operates effectively on that CRM system.
The cross-functional nature of CRM deployment is a defining characteristic. It necessitates close collaboration and input from various departments, including marketing, sales, customer service, operations, and information technology. Each department possesses unique use cases, data requirements, and workflows that must be integrated into the CRM strategy. Without a clearly designated owner and a structured, overarching plan, deployment efforts are prone to scope creep, missed milestones, and the creation of a technically functional system that ultimately fails to gain traction among its intended users. Early clarity on system boundaries, particularly when integrating with other enterprise systems like Enterprise Resource Planning (ERP), is vital. Understanding the distinctions between ERP and CRM, and mapping out how they will interact, can significantly reduce rework and potential conflicts down the line.

Aligning Goals and Requirements: The Foundation of Success
The critical first step in any CRM deployment is requirements alignment. It is impossible to effectively configure a CRM system to support business operations if the fundamental needs and objectives of those operations have not been clearly defined. This phase demands comprehensive input from every team that will interact with the CRM. Marketing teams will have specific needs for lead generation and campaign management, sales teams will focus on pipeline management and customer interaction tracking, and service teams will require tools for issue resolution and customer support.
To achieve this alignment, structured discovery workshops with each stakeholder group are indispensable. These sessions should involve presenting draft process maps and example workflows, inviting active feedback and refinement from participants. Crucially, defining three to five key performance indicators (KPIs) for the deployment upfront is essential. These metrics, such as data completeness, user login frequency, or pipeline accuracy, will serve as benchmarks to measure the CRM’s success from day one, moving beyond simply counting the number of licenses procured.
A best practice during this phase is to document requirements as user stories rather than generic feature requests. For instance, "As a sales representative, I need to see a contact’s last three interactions before a call" is a specific, testable requirement. In contrast, "We need activity logging" is too broad and lacks actionable detail. This phase is also the opportune moment to establish clear standards for contact management, defining what constitutes a contact, essential data fields, and protocols for handling duplicate records.
Crafting the CRM Implementation Plan: A Blueprint for Action
A robust CRM implementation plan serves as the blueprint for the entire deployment process. It must comprehensively outline the project’s scope, key milestones, budget allocations, assigned ownership, identified risks, and a clear change control process. Defining the scope precisely—what is included and, importantly, what is explicitly excluded from Phase 1—is vital for managing expectations and preventing scope creep.
A detailed milestone schedule, incorporating realistic buffer time, is crucial. Industry data suggests that a significant majority of CRM implementations (around 63%) exceed their projected timelines, with average overruns ranging from 30% to 50%. Therefore, building contingency into the schedule is not merely prudent but essential. The budget should also include a reserve of 15% to 20% to accommodate unforeseen expenses.
A RACI (Responsible, Accountable, Consulted, Informed) matrix, with clearly named individuals assigned to each role, ensures accountability throughout the project. A risk register, documenting the top five potential risks and mitigation strategies, is also a critical component. Finally, a well-defined change control process provides a mechanism for evaluating and managing any new requests that arise during the deployment, ensuring they are assessed for their impact on scope, timeline, and budget.
Investing a significant portion of the project budget, typically 10% to 15%, in thorough discovery and scoping upfront has been shown to yield substantially better outcomes compared to rushing into the configuration phase.
Configuration and Integration: Building the Core Functionality
During the configuration phase, the focus should be on building only what is essential for the teams on day one. This typically involves establishing the core data model, which includes contacts, companies, and deals, along with defining the sales pipeline stages. These stages should accurately reflect how customers naturally progress through the sales funnel within the organization. Limiting custom properties to fields that users will realistically populate helps maintain data integrity and system usability.
For integrations, a lean and functional set of connections is preferable to an ambitious and potentially unstable map of interconnected systems. Many CRM platforms offer extensive integration ecosystems that can accommodate common connection points, allowing for incremental development. Tools like data hubs can further facilitate native data synchronization and deduplication across connected platforms, ensuring data consistency from the outset.
A critical best practice in configuration is to always perform changes in a sandbox environment before implementing them in the production system. This step is frequently bypassed when timelines become compressed, but it is one that is almost universally regretted due to the potential for introducing errors into the live environment.
Data Migration and Cleaning: Ensuring Data Integrity
The process of migrating and cleaning data for CRM deployment is a complex undertaking that requires meticulous profiling, mapping, deduplication, validation, and a robust rollback plan. A staggering 76% of CRM users report that less than half of their CRM data is accurate and complete, and a concerning 37% have directly lost revenue due to poor data quality. This highlights the imperative to not assume source data is clean.
Data profiling should be conducted before any migration begins, assessing volume, completeness by field, duplicate rates, and identifying records that should not be transferred. Every field from the source system must be mapped to its destination in the CRM, with all transformation rules clearly documented and stakeholder sign-off obtained before executing migration scripts. Deduplication efforts should ideally be performed on the source data prior to migration, as cleaning duplicates within a new system is considerably more challenging than preventing their entry.
A pilot migration, using a representative subset of the data, should be executed first to validate completeness and field mapping before committing to the full dataset. Realistic migration timelines often span 8 to 12 weeks, contingent on early profiling efforts. A well-defined rollback plan, specifying the conditions for execution, the responsible parties, and the precise steps involved, is crucial for mitigating risks. Ongoing data hygiene practices beyond the initial migration are also essential for maintaining data quality.
Testing: Validating System Functionality
Before the go-live, comprehensive testing is non-negotiable. This encompasses unit testing, integration testing, end-to-end testing, user acceptance testing (UAT), security testing, and performance testing. Unit testing verifies individual fields and automation rules, while integration testing confirms seamless data flow between connected systems. End-to-end testing simulates complete user journeys for each defined role.
User Acceptance Testing (UAT) involves actual end-users interacting with the system based on real workflows. At least one week should be allocated for testing, and any failed test cases should be treated as go-live blockers. Security testing ensures that each user role has appropriate access levels, and performance testing validates the system’s ability to handle realistic user loads.
Developing a formal UAT test case library that directly maps to the original requirements is a highly effective strategy. This ensures that the system is being verified against the stated objectives and promises, rather than relying on subjective user impressions.
Training and Adoption: Driving User Engagement
Despite the availability of advanced CRM technology, less than 40% of CRM systems achieve full adoption within companies. The primary barrier is not a lack of awareness but the perception that the CRM represents additional work rather than a replacement for inefficient workarounds.
Training programs should be designed around the daily workflows of each specific role, rather than focusing solely on platform features. Frontline managers play a pivotal role in driving adoption; their consistent inquiry into whether tasks are being performed within the CRM and their reinforcement of good data hygiene practices in team meetings can significantly accelerate user engagement. When managers do not actively promote CRM usage, training efforts tend to fade rapidly.
Identifying "CRM champions" within each team before go-live is a strategic advantage. These are respected peers who have participated in UAT and can effectively answer questions in the flow of daily work. Champions can significantly reduce the load on help desks and foster adoption more effectively than formal training sessions alone.
Orchestrating Go-Live and Hypercare: The Critical Transition
The go-live phase requires a meticulously planned cutover strategy, clearly defined go/no-go criteria, comprehensive user communications, and a responsive hypercare support model. Go/no-go blockers should be documented well in advance of the cutover week. Typical criteria include a UAT pass rate exceeding 95%, validated data migration, provisioned user accounts, verified integrations, and completed training. Any unmet criteria necessitate a delay in the go-live.
User communications should commence at least one week prior to launch, with follow-up messages on launch day and immediately afterward, providing clear access to support resources. A concise "what to do on day one" reference card can be immensely helpful for users.
Hypercare refers to the intensive support period of two to four weeks following the launch. During this time, system health is closely monitored, questions are addressed in real-time, and issues are resolved before they become ingrained workarounds. A dedicated hypercare lead who manages issue triage and communicates status updates to stakeholders is crucial for this phase. This period is pivotal for cementing adoption; success or failure here can significantly impact the long-term effectiveness of the CRM.

Measuring Outcomes and Iterating: Continuous Improvement
CRM deployment is not a finite project that concludes at go-live. Continuous measurement against the KPIs established during the requirements alignment phase is essential. This includes monitoring user login frequency, data completeness by record type, pipeline health, lead response times, and reporting adoption rates. The value of a CRM database grows exponentially with clean data and erodes rapidly without consistent governance. Monthly data quality reviews during the first quarter are highly recommended.
Adoption data and user feedback should inform a prioritized backlog of Phase 2 improvements. A post-mortem analysis conducted within 30 days of go-live, while lessons are still fresh, is invaluable for capturing insights and refining future deployment strategies.
Governance for CRM Deployment: Sustaining Long-Term Health
Effective CRM governance establishes clear decision-making rights, approval processes, accountability structures, and documentation standards that ensure the CRM system remains healthy and valuable long after its initial launch. Without robust governance, even a well-deployed CRM can slowly degrade into the same chaotic state it was intended to resolve.
The RACI matrix is a foundational governance tool, clarifying responsibilities for every workstream within the deployment. From requirements gathering and configuration to data migration, integrations, testing, training, communications, and ongoing administration, each major task should have a clearly defined owner and documented RACI assignments.
A CRM steering committee, often comprised of a senior leadership sponsor, CRM leads from each major department, and the system administrator, is essential. This group, meeting regularly (weekly during active deployment and monthly thereafter), makes critical decisions regarding system changes, prioritizes enhancements, and escalates adoption issues.
A formal change control process is the bulwark against scope creep. Every request for new fields, automation logic modifications, or new integrations must undergo a defined intake process. These requests are then reviewed against their impact on scope, resources, and timeline, and are either approved for the current phase, deferred to a future backlog, or declined with a documented rationale. This process is not about bureaucracy but about ensuring projects remain on track and deliver tangible value.
Documentation norms are often underestimated. The CRM system should be thoroughly documented, including the purpose of custom properties, definitions of pipeline stages, lifecycle stage criteria, and the integration architecture. When key personnel depart, undocumented systems can become impenetrable black boxes. Documentation should be an ongoing process, not an afterthought.
Workers spend an average of 13 hours per week searching for information within their CRM. A well-governed system with a clear taxonomy, mandatory fields, and consistent data entry practices can dramatically reduce this time. Creating a downloadable RACI template and populating it with specific names and workstreams, rather than generic job titles, ensures it is utilized effectively. Similarly, a simple change control intake form that captures the requestor, description, business justification, estimated impact, and priority level provides the structure needed for consistent decision-making. Tracking all requests in a shared backlog ensures transparency and prevents items from being lost.

CRM Rollout Strategy Options: Tailoring the Approach
There is no one-size-fits-all approach to CRM deployment strategy. The optimal choice depends on an organization’s size, complexity, risk tolerance, and readiness for change. Selecting the incorrect rollout strategy can be a significant, yet preventable, deployment mistake. The three primary approaches include:
-
Phased Rollout: This strategy involves deploying the CRM in sequential waves, typically by team, business unit, geography, or a specific set of features. The organization starts with one group, gathers feedback, makes adjustments, and then proceeds to the next wave. This approach is well-suited for large enterprises, geographically dispersed organizations, or those with highly complex processes, as it allows for learning and adaptation. It also works effectively for organizations with higher resistance to change, as each change event is smaller in scope.
-
Pilot Rollout: In this model, the CRM is initially deployed to a small, representative group of users (approximately 10-20% of the total user base). This pilot group validates the configuration, training materials, and support model before the full organizational deployment. This strategy is often favored by mid-market teams validating a new CRM for the first time, as it offers a lower-risk pathway to full implementation.
-
Big-Bang Rollout: This approach involves deploying the CRM to all users simultaneously on a single cutover date. While it offers the fastest path to full deployment on paper, it carries the highest risk. Issues encountered during a big-bang launch affect the entire organization at once, making recovery more challenging. This strategy is best suited for small teams with simple processes and a strong executive mandate for rapid adoption. It requires a high degree of change readiness across the organization.
The choice between these strategies impacts complexity, risk, change readiness, and the time to achieve full value. A phased approach generally offers lower risk and works well for resistant organizations, while a big-bang approach is fastest but requires significant change readiness and carries higher risk if issues arise.
When to Leverage a Partner for CRM Deployment
While some organizations can successfully manage CRM deployments internally, many growing teams with complex processes, significant data migration requirements, or limited internal bandwidth benefit immensely from partnering with an experienced implementation firm. The key is to identify the right type of partner and define their role clearly.
Engaging a partner is strongly recommended in several scenarios:
- Migrating from a Complex Existing CRM: Data migrations between CRM platforms, especially those involving custom objects, intricate field mappings, and large data volumes, are fraught with potential for costly errors. A partner with proven migration experience on your specific source and target platforms can significantly de-risk this process.
- Multiple Critical Integrations: When the CRM requires integration with an ERP, a proprietary data warehouse, custom sales tools, or a complex marketing automation stack, the integration architecture decisions have long-term implications. Incorrectly implemented integrations can lead to rework that is exponentially more expensive than getting them right the first time.
- Limited Internal Bandwidth: A CRM deployment managed as a secondary responsibility alongside a full-time job is a deployment destined for delays, corner-cutting, or both. If dedicated internal capacity cannot be allocated to the project, a partner can fill this critical gap.
- Significant Change Resistance: Partners specializing in CRM deployments often bring established change management frameworks, adoption playbooks, and training materials that internal teams may lack the time or expertise to develop from scratch.
- Lack of Prior Experience: For organizations undertaking their first CRM deployment or their first deployment on a particular platform, a partner can substantially mitigate the learning curve and associated risks.
Conversely, an organization with a small user base (under 10 users), well-defined standard processes, strong self-serve onboarding resources from the CRM vendor, and sufficient internal capacity may not require an external partner.
When engaging a partner, it is crucial to establish a clear division of responsibilities. A successful partnership model does not involve outsourcing the entire deployment. Internal ownership of requirements, data governance, and ongoing administration yields superior outcomes. The partner should contribute implementation expertise and project bandwidth, while the internal team provides essential business context and long-term ownership. A sample RACI split with a deployment partner illustrates this collaborative approach, with the internal team typically retaining accountability for requirements and UAT, while the partner takes responsibility for configuration and data migration execution.
Tools and Templates for Streamlined Deployment
A CRM deployment is as much a project management and change management challenge as it is a technical one. The right tools and templates are essential for maintaining organization, alignment, and auditability throughout the process.
Key resources at each stage include:
- Deployment Readiness Checklist: This pre-kickoff tool assesses executive sponsorship, a named project owner, a cross-functional steering group, a documented timeline, and defined success metrics. Without these foundational elements, initiating configuration is premature.
- CRM Implementation Plan: This master project document outlines scope, milestones, owners, budget, and the risk register. It should be reviewed regularly by the steering group and updated to reflect any changes.
- RACI Template: A matrix that assigns Responsible, Accountable, Consulted, and Informed roles to every workstream. Populating this with actual names, not just job titles, ensures clarity and accountability.
- Data Migration Mapping Sheet: A detailed field-by-field map from source to destination systems, including transformation rules, required/optional status in the destination, and the data owner responsible for sign-off. This sheet serves as the definitive source of truth for data migration logic.
- UAT Test Script: A library of test cases organized by user role and workflow, documenting test steps, expected results, actual results, and pass/fail status. UAT should be conducted against documented scripts, not ad-hoc explorations.
- Training Plan: A role-by-role breakdown of training objectives, delivery formats (live sessions, videos, guides), timing, and completion tracking. This plan should identify and include CRM champions.
- Hypercare Runbook: A document detailing the issue intake process, escalation paths, on-call responsibilities, daily check-in cadences, and service level agreements (SLAs) for issue resolution during the critical post-launch period.
- Post-Launch Optimization Backlog: A dynamic list of Phase 2 enhancements, deferred requirements, and user feedback items, prioritized by business impact. This backlog should be reviewed and reprioritized monthly to ensure continuous improvement.

Frequently Asked Questions About CRM Deployment
How long does a typical CRM deployment take?
Deployment timelines vary significantly based on organizational size and complexity. Small businesses typically complete deployments in one to three months. Mid-sized organizations generally require three to six months, while large enterprises can expect six to twelve months or longer. Industry data indicates that approximately 78% of projects fall within the three-to-six-month window. However, timelines can frequently extend by 30% to 50% when data quality or integration issues emerge mid-deployment. Building buffer time into the schedule is therefore crucial.
What is the best way to migrate data without downtime?
Minimizing downtime during data migration is achieved through a staged approach rather than a single cutover. This involves profiling and cleaning source data thoroughly, conducting a pilot migration on a representative data subset, validating its accuracy, and then executing the full migration in a pre-production environment before impacting the live system. Scheduling the final cutover during a low-traffic period, having a robust rollback plan ready, and keeping the old system in read-only mode during validation are essential steps.
Should we phase our rollout or do a big-bang launch?
For most organizations, a phased or pilot approach is preferable to a big-bang launch, unless the team is small, processes are simple, and change readiness is exceptionally high. Phased rollouts contain failures to smaller groups, allowing for iterative improvements. Big-bang launches, while seemingly faster on paper, can incur significant time costs when widespread issues arise.
How do we prevent scope creep during deployment?
Preventing scope creep requires explicit definition of Phase 1 scope, including a clear delineation of what is out of scope. Every new request must be channeled through a formal change control intake process, resulting in an approved, deferred, or declined decision with documented rationale. Uncontrolled scope changes are a primary driver of missed deadlines and budget overruns in CRM projects.
When should we hire an implementation partner?
Consider hiring an implementation partner when dealing with complex data migration, multiple critical integrations, limited internal bandwidth, or significant organizational resistance to change. For small teams with standard processes, an internal approach may suffice. If a partner is engaged, maintain internal ownership of requirements and ongoing administration, allowing the partner to contribute execution expertise.
